Broadcast.com (BCST) announced a five year partnership with Level 3 Communications stating that the company will use L3's IP network as the primary distribution channel for Broadcast.com's broadband content. They will also work together to improve media streaming and broadband delivery technologies.

Level 3 Communications and Broadcast.com today entered into a strategic pact that will give the Web media programmer broadband access at favorable pricing. The companies said in a statement that under the terms of the five-year strategic alliance, Broadcast.com would use Level 3's international Internet Protocol network to deliver its audio and video content to customers at reduced fees. In addition, Level 3, an Internet communications company, will use Broadcast.com as its sole provider of Internet broadcasting. - News.com
